20150063331 | ACCESS POINT DETECTION - A wireless communications device has network interfaces for accessing cellular data networks and Wi-Fi wireless local area networks. Wi-Fi offload allows data traffic to be moved away from the cellular network to the Wi-Fi network. To avoid any existing data sessions being broken during offload, Proxy Mobile IP (PMIP) must be supported by a Wi-Fi access point and associated Mobile Access Gateway. Before Wi-Fi association and authentication, the wireless communication device scans the surrounding area for access points and determines which of the access points supports PMIP before selecting one for association. | 03-05-2015 |

20150218484 | METHOD FOR OBTAINING A LIPID-CONTAINING COMPOSITION FROM MICROBIAL BIOMASS - Methods are provided for pelletizing a microbial biomass, extracting a refined lipid composition from the pelletized biomass under supercritical conditions and distilling the refined lipid composition, at least once under short path distillation conditions, to obtain a lipid-containing fraction. Also disclosed are methods of making lipid-containing oil concentrates therefrom, by transesterifying and enriching the lipid-containing fraction. | 08-06-2015 |

20150017623 | METHOD AND APPARATUS FOR NEUROMOTOR REHABILITATION USING INTERACTIVE SETTING SYSTEMS - The invention provides a method and an apparatus for neuromotor rehabilitation by using virtual and interactive environments which allow the subject or patient to carry out rehabilitative training, and to collect functional parameters concerning the neuromotor aspect. Said method offers in only one apparatus a play means, a rehabilitative equipment and a device for collecting and analyzing specific medical parameters. The method can be used according to two modes: the assisted and independent one. The subject is represented in a virtual setting in which he is asked to carry out precise activities in order to reach a target aim and, at the same time, to use or summon up motor pattern studied by rehabilitation therapists; during the activity the equipment records a very significant quantity of previously selected data which are classified, processed, compared and analyzed by means of a dedicated data management software. | 01-15-2015 |
